  3. The game suffers in my opinion because the reward for killing a noob is the same as the hard earned reward of killing a very experienced player. This is why most players prefer hunting in nations green zones than they do looking up where Captain Reverse is streaming and try killing him. So what if the game gave people on a kill streak or with a very high kill to death ratio some kind of flag or title. Killing a person with that flag or title would yield much higher rewards in marks than killing a noob. Perhaps sighting of these notorious admirals could be reported in combat news. Make it worth while all he effort it takes to fight someone like Reverse rather than farming hapless fools. The more skilled player is the more notorious he should become and more of a bounty the game should have on his head. Perhaps then people will go out looking for these people and spend les time looking for easier wins.

Tagging could be a 180 degree arc in front of a ship, this would stop people tagging a ship while running away from it, defensive tag would only be possible if the ship at least turned towards the enemy, once the tag timer starts both ships should of course be free to turn how they like. I think repairs are too fast and too much and the fact you can repair sails with them fully up seems to a bit much for me drags a fight out longer than necessary. Perhaps a perk to increase battle timer to 5 or 10 mins
